I am working on Foxit PDF SDK implemented in our app. Anyone who have used it knows that they have UiExtension library which provides us the functionality of the pdf from its core libraries. Now if we have to change something in any tool provided by Foxit, we have to make changes in UiExtension. Every things works great but the problem is now we have to update the SDK and UiExtension code will be updated and everything will be replaced i.e we have to compare every file and get the changes we made. I couldn't figure out the efficient way to make changes in UiExtension so that we wont have to go through the same trauma again and update every file. Any suggestions would be highly appreciated.
Foxit PDF SDK - How to efficiently Update UI Extension methods
129 Views Asked by Hassan Dar At
1
There are 1 best solutions below
Related Questions in ANDROID
- Creating global Class holder
- Flutter + Dart: Editing name of a tab shows up a black screen
- android-pdf-viewer Received status code 401 from server: Unauthorized
- Sdk 34 WRITE_EXTERNAL_STORAGE not working
- ussd reader in Recket Native module
- Incorrect display of LinearGradientBrush in IOS
- The Binary Version Of its metadata is 1.8.0, expected Version is 1.6.0 build error
- I can't make TextInput to auto expand properly in Android
- Creating multiple instances of a class with different initializing values in Flutter
- How to create a lottie animation
- making android analyze with coverity sast tool
- Flutter plugin development android src not opening after opening example
- I initialize my ViewModel in the Activity with several fragments as tabs, but the fragments(tabs) return null for the updated livedata
- Node.js Server + Socket.IO + Android Mobile Applicatoin XHR Polling Error...?
- How I can use the shared preferences class?
Related Questions in PDF
- How to use custom font during html to pdf conversion?
- How to get content of BLOCK types LAYOUT_TITLE, LAYOUT_SECTION_HEADER and LAYOUT_xx in Textract
- PDF form checkbox/radio button ignores content stream
- Suggest python library for rendering html to pdf files
- Problems with the order in which PDF files are created
- Centering a map element on a generated PDF
- download all pdf files from website doesn't support wildcard
- How to enter external pdf into quarto book while keeping page layout+numbering
- How do I create a website that combines user input and standard text and converts it into a pdf?
- Excel VBA error 1004 on PDF export - not a path issue
- downloading pdf using requests not working
- Creating pdf on Firestore with Pdfplum: Template path "no such object"
- Export password protected PDF from QGIS
- XPS convert PDF with Ghostscript
- Download PDF in ASP.NET MVC application
Related Questions in SDK
- DirectX 9 With No SDK Installed - How To Translate a D3DMATRIX?
- Error "_IframeMessenger_get Target Origin is not defined" when starting the project. Autodesk Forma SDK
- `android` Does Not Exist in `~/Android/Sdk/platform-tools`
- -> Requested enabled DevSupportManager, but DevSupportManagerImpl class was not found
- Anyone know of javascript library to dynamically create mappings?
- Short time token with the Graph API and Facebook login through the iOS SDK
- I cannot install the dotnet-sdk-8.0.203-win-x64 version
- Im using mapbox sdk navigation v2 and have a problem with the cycling view
- Azure App Configuration - Replica for 429 HTTP responses
- Connected device (the doctor check crashed)
- Cannot find protocol declaration for 'TransactionHandlerDelegate'" (Swift/MAUI Interop)
- Flutter SDK: Files Deleted Automatically (e.g., dart.exe), Errors in Android Studio
- Mac Sonoma 14.4 Dotnet 8.0.203 SDK webapi https error
- No SDK on Intellij IDEA with jdk17 Installed
- Autodesk RCP, RCS files reading
Related Questions in FOXIT
- Automate PDF Forms Based on Excel Data
- How to insert dynamic picture in PDF Document (ADOBE PRO or FoxIT)
- Pyinstaller not including the FoxitSDK module when turning a .py to an executable
- How to convert a Scanned PDF file using Foxit Libraries
- Is there a way to make radio buttons in Foxit PDF Editor auto select when the user picks an object from a drop down menu?
- Total Pages of Active Foxit Window using Autohotkey
- Random number generated per .pdf form
- Office COM Exception occurs on Office to PDF Conversion Foxit PDF Sdk
- How to transform png file to pdf with Foxit in VBA
- Retrieve result from sqlite Foxit SDK FullTextSearch
- FoxitPhantom pdf to Excel Automation
- Digital signature not visible in Adobe reader but visible in Foxit reader
- Proper Importation of Foxit's WebPDF Engine Into React App
- How to use Foxit Phantom PDF invisibly
- Merge pdf files with VBA and Foxit
Related Questions in FOXIT-READER
- Cannot change font color to black in Foxit Reader (Ubuntu)
- When generating a RMarkdown PDF from Shiny, PDF saving and printing is disabled
- FoxitReader printing without preview
- Retrieve result from sqlite Foxit SDK FullTextSearch
- Previewing pdf files in MS Access and Foxit Reader webbrowser control fires print event
- Error displaying the digital signature font when using itextsharp on adobe reader
- "Unexpected byte range values defining scope of signed data" when signing a pdf
- Merge PDF's or convert to PDF using Foxit Reader 9.7 or CutePDF Writer
- Executing a command line program from C# with Process.Start() is up to 10 times slower?
- Shortcut keys for Foxit in macro
- Highlighting the text content in PDF with foxit pdf library
- Cannot run command using cmd in Windows 10
- Aspect ratio of FSPDFViewCtrl
- foxit reader shows wrong aspect ratio, contents are vertically stretched
- signature seems to be signed in future error while verify signature in foxit
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ular # Hahtags
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
Usually only major version, like version 5.x to 6.x, changes will result in the API from the Foxit PDF SDK for iOS/Android to change. Since, the UIExtension is uses the Foxit PDF SDK for iOS/Android to provide you the UI from either iOS or Android. If you are just doing a minor change, like version 6.3 to 6.4, the changes in the API are less likely. In cases of minor changes, you can just keep your old UIExtension.
The best way to trouble shoot this is to integrate the the UIExtension project into your iOS or android project. This way you can switch out the Foxit PDF SDK library and see what errors it may cause with your project. For details on this, please see "Customize UI implementation through the source code" in FoxitDeveloperGuideForiOS or FoxitDeveloperGuideForAndroid.